These things shot REALLY good from 2 different rifles, 2 different powders and charges, i was shooting 70 Weight grains of Swiss 3F, and my dad was shooting 100 volume Grains of Goex 2F, Targets were 80 Yards, my 3 shot group was close to an inch, and my dads was close to the same. This bullet in .54 Cal doesn't seem to be at all finicky? its a DARN good looking hunting bullet, nice wide Meplat, should be a HAMMER on Game

I picked this mold up brand new fairly cheap at an estate sale type thing, i was thinking more about my dad when i got it. His rifle shoots a Maxi Ball really good. I got him to try a few of my paper patch bullets the other day, he shot a 1" group with them or right at it, i stil don't think i will ever convert him from grease bullets to PP bullets

192017
This is my dad's target, the bottom 3 vertical shots were my PP bullets i talked him into trying, 515 Grain from my custom .533 Mold, the top 4 were These Lyman Bullets greased and loaded like a Maxi ball.

192018
And here is my target, Same Lyman bullets above except sized to .538, Double wrap onion skin paper patched and ran back through the .538 die. I tried the .539 but this particular bore was to tight for that, i had to resize to .538

How do these bullets load into your barrel or barrels ? Are they a slip fit ? Do they load like a R.E.A.L. ? Or do they need to be sized ?

I didn't load and shoot any greased so i don't know first hand? I didn't pay attention to my dad when he loaded, but he did tell me that they loaded nice (better than the Maxi's) i am a dedicated Paper Patched shooter, the ones i shot were sized to .538, then 2 wraps of paper and back through the .538 sizer, they slide down the barrel REALLY nice. As i said previously i tried .539 first, i loaded it, but it was really tight, so i sized the rest to .538, this particular barrel has a tight bore, my other Scout 54 barrel takes the .539 great, my Lyman Great Plains Hunter .54, 2 Renegade 54s, and New Englander .54 all like the .539, And a friend of mine (Forum member Harleysboss) tried my .539s through his Knight MK-85 and he said they loaded great. I have found .539 to be the ticket for most .54s
